So i am using Rniap for in-app purchases. The thing is everything works well when i am testing on my machine but when I upload the app on testflight and log in as a sandbox tester and invoke receipt validationios I always get status 27001. Any ideas?

@HamzaIkram2727 The way I handle this is that when I validate the iOS receipt, I first assume it's going to the production environment. Then I check the response and if it's 21007, I validate again by sending to sandbox environment.
